Duomo di Milano | Is this the most beautiful cathedral?

The Milan Cathedral or Duomo di Milano, dedicated to Santa Maria Nascente, is at the very center of the city and the Piazza del Duomo. It is the fifth largest cathedral in the world and the largest in the Italian state territory. The Reichstag, Berlin | Seat of the German Parliament

The Reichstag building (German: Reichstagsgebäude) is a historical edifice in Berlin, Germany, constructed between 1884 and 1894, and is a must visit attraction.
